Attached is volume 9 of the LaSalle County Nuclear Station Equipment Qualification Post-Audit Documentation.

This submittal provides a current status report of equipment being SQRT qualified since our submittal in Reference (a).

This report closes out eighteen (18) items of equipment as being SQRT qualified.

The following items remain to be tested in the SQRT program for LaSalle County Station:

1. IiT Barton 7660 level switch - scheduled for October 26, 1581, testing.
2. Hammond-Dahl 2" globe valve with NAMCO limit switch -

January 1982 test.
